Zelensky imposed sanctions on Assad

President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elensky imposed personal sanctions on Syrian President Bashar al-Assad for 10 years.

Axar.az reports that the order was published on the website of the President of Ukraine.

Along with Assad, Zelensky imposed sanctions on 300 individuals and 141 legal entities by the decision of the National Security and Defense Council.

It was reported that 3 of them are citizens of Syria, 7 of them are citizens of Iran and the rest are citizens of Russia.

It should be noted that on March 14, during his visit to Moscow, Bashar Assad recognized the regions of Ukraine annexed by Russia as the territories of the federation.
